Tools for structured iterative refinement between AI agents and humans. Documents bounce back and forth between agents using disagreement markers until they converge, producing tighter and more precise output than any single agent would alone.

| Task shape | Tool |
|---|---|
| General question, idea, strategy, draft, or argument | co-evolve-bouncer.sh |
| Existing markdown document needs refinement | co-evolve-bouncer.sh --bounce-only |
| Small, low-risk repo edit in 1-2 files | Direct execution |
| Multi-file code change, medium/high risk, or plan/verify workflow | dev-review/codex/dev-review.sh |
| General co-evolution inside Claude Code | skills/co-evolution/ |
| Code pipeline inside Claude Code | skills/dev-review/ |
The shared foundation. Two markers - [CONTESTED] and [CLARIFY] - coordinate
structured disagreement between agents. Both auto-expire after 2 passes,
guaranteeing convergence. The protocol is customizable: swap in domain-specific
markers, adjust convergence rules, change role lenses.
